Jon Brandon Harrison Gartman

Jon Brandon Harrison Gartman (51) of Biloxi Mississippi passed away on Saturday December 5, 2020. The son of Jonny Duane Gartman and Susan Lee Caraway Gartman, Brandon grew up in Midwest City, Oklahoma with his brother Russel Lloyd McKeever Gartman. Brandon was known for his expression of joy, his generosity, his humor, and storytelling abilities. Brandon’s mother, Susan, was his heart, providing the foundation from which he developed into the very kind and loving man known by all. Brandon’s dad, Jon D, was his hero, teaching him his tremendous work ethic and a great love of fast cars and huge trucks. His Uncle Mike taught him his great love of water and fast boats. Brandon also loved learning. He put himself through college and received a Master’s in Business Administration from Loyola University in Chicago. In 2019, Brandon was named the Chief Operating Officer of Sears Hometown Stores, responsible for over 300 Sears stores. Brandon began his thirty-three-year career with Sears in high school. He started on the sales floor of the local Sears store, where he was quickly promoted and began training new sales associates. Other stores heard about him and soon he was training Oklahoma City-wide, then regionally, and finally brought to Sears Headquarters in Chicago where he rose through the ranks. Brandon was preceded in death by his dad, Jon D. and his grandparents Lloyd and Wanda Caraway and Red and Opal Gartman. Brandon is survived by his mother Susan; Jonathan Russell; stepdaughters, Karyn (Alex), Kailey (Jake) and Claire; his brother Russell and wife Angela and their children, Harrison and Michael; his Uncle Mike, Aunt Kate and his Aunt Jo and Uncle Kerry. He is also survived by a very loving and supportive set of Aunts, Uncles, Cousins, and lifelong best friends Scotty, Mike & Kim along with a wealth of friends, including previous spouse Keri, and co-workers throughout the United States who appreciated his leadership abilities. A virtual Celebration of Brandon’s Life will be held in January 2021. Details will be released at a later date. In lieu of flowers, please send a donation to your favorite charity in Brandon’s name.
